What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Albany CPA Firms?

AEO — Answer Engine Optimization — is the practice of structuring your website content so that AI systems, voice assistants, and Google’s answer features pull your firm’s information as the authoritative response to a user’s question. Think of it as SEO’s forward-looking cousin. Where traditional SEO earns you a spot on a list of ten blue links, AEO earns you the answer itself.

For a CPA firm, the practical impact is significant. When a business owner in the Warehouse District asks Google Assistant, “What accounting firm near me handles LLC formation in New York?” the AI doesn’t return a list — it names one firm. AEO is how you become that firm. It involves writing clear, question-and-answer structured content, implementing structured data markup as described by Google Search Central, building your local entity signals, and earning citations from authoritative sources that reinforce your expertise in Albany’s market.

The Core AEO Signals Your CPA Website Needs Right Now

AEO is built on a handful of foundational signals. Getting these right is what separates firms that show up in AI answers from those that don’t.

Structured content organized around questions. Your service pages should answer the questions your ideal client is already asking: “How much does a CPA cost in Albany, NY?” “Do I need a CPA or an enrolled agent for an IRS audit?” “What’s the difference between a CPA and a bookkeeper for my small business?” These aren’t just keywords — they’re the exact queries that AI systems scan when building an answer.

Schema markup. FAQ schema, LocalBusiness schema, and Professional Service schema signal to Google and AI crawlers that your content is structured, trustworthy, and location-specific. Without it, even excellent content gets overlooked in favor of a competitor who has it.

Google Business Profile completeness. For Downtown Albany CPA firms, your GBP is essentially your AEO foundation. Services listed, Q&A populated, reviews mentioning specific services — all of these feed directly into how AI tools describe your firm when someone asks a location-based accounting question.

Authoritative local citations. Being listed and consistent across the Albany County Bar Association directory, the New York State Society of CPAs, and local Chamber of Commerce listings tells AI systems that your firm is a genuine, established entity in this market.

AEO vs. Traditional SEO for CPA Firms: What’s the Difference?

Traditional SEO focuses on ranking for keyword phrases — “Albany CPA firm” or “tax preparation Downtown Albany.” It earns you a spot in the ranked list of results. AEO takes a different angle: it optimizes for the moment before the click, when Google or an AI assistant is constructing its answer. You’re not just competing for position — you’re competing to be the source.

The two strategies work best together. Your SEO foundation builds authority and earns rankings; your AEO layer converts that authority into direct citations, featured snippets, and voice search answers. For CPA firms in Downtown Albany who already rank reasonably well but aren’t getting the call volume they expect, AEO is often the missing layer. It’s the difference between someone seeing your listing and someone hearing your firm’s name spoken aloud by their phone.

Frequently Asked Questions About AEO for Albany CPA Firms

What does AEO mean for a CPA firm’s website?

AEO stands for Answer Engine Optimization. For a CPA firm, it means structuring your website content — service pages, blog posts, FAQ sections — so that AI tools and Google’s answer features cite your firm when someone asks an accounting question relevant to your location and services. It’s about being the answer, not just a result.

How is AEO different from SEO for accounting firms in Albany?

Traditional SEO earns your firm a ranking among a list of results. AEO optimizes your content so that AI systems, voice assistants, and Google’s featured snippets select your firm as the direct answer to a query. Both matter, but AEO specifically targets the zero-click, pre-click moment when the search engine constructs its answer.

How long does it take AEO to produce results for a Downtown Albany CPA firm?

Most firms begin seeing measurable improvements in featured snippet appearances and local AI citations within two to four months of a properly executed AEO strategy. The timeline depends on your site’s existing authority, the competitiveness of your target queries, and how thoroughly your content has been restructured around questions.

Does my CPA firm need a large website to benefit from AEO?

No. Even a focused, well-structured five- to ten-page website can perform strongly in AEO if it answers specific, high-intent questions clearly, carries proper schema markup, and is backed by consistent local citations. Depth and clarity matter more than volume when it comes to earning AI-generated citations.

Will AEO help my Albany CPA firm compete against national tax chains?

Yes — and it’s one of your strongest competitive advantages. National chains like H&R Block have broad authority, but they can’t answer hyper-local Albany questions the way a Downtown firm can. Content that addresses New York State-specific tax rules, Albany County business regulations, and Capital Region market nuances wins the local AEO game that national brands can’t play as well.

What’s the first step to improving AEO for my CPA firm?

Start with a content and schema audit of your existing website. Identify the questions your ideal clients are asking — especially ones related to Albany and upstate New York tax issues — and evaluate whether your current pages answer them clearly, concisely, and with proper structured data.
